Method 2: Alt-Print

Screenshots are saved in a folder titled Screenshots in your Pictures folder. The Capture window will show the active window in the bottom pane. If you want to capture the full screen, make sure no particular window is active. You can do that by clicking on the taskbar before pressing the Windows key + G. In this case, you can press the first two Print Screen commands to automatically save an image file to OneDrive. You won’t see the screen flicker or dim for these commands — you’ll receive a notification instead.
